Visa and Mastercard near settlement with merchants, would lower fees, WSJ reports
Nov 8, 2025 6:21 PM

Nov 8 (Reuters) - U.S. payment firms Visa and

Mastercard ( MA ) are nearing a settlement with merchants that

aims to end a 20-year-old legal dispute by lowering fees stores

pay and giving them more power to reject certain credit cards,

the Wall Street Journal reported on Saturday, citing people

familiar with matter.

Reuters could not immediately verify the report.
